NCT03033628
Pain Perception of Dental Local Anesthesia Using "DentalVibe Comfort System" in a Group of Egyptian Children
NA trial testing injection using DentalVibe comfort system in Dental Anxiety in 21 participants. Status unknown.

Sponsor's own description
The aim of this study is to compare pain during maxillary infiltration local anesthesia injection with the aid of DentalVibe comfort system in comparison to maxillary infiltration injection alone in pediatric dental patients.
